Nathalie Ivanoff is a scholar working on Dermatology, Parasitology and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Nathalie Ivanoff has authored 10 papers receiving a total of 425 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 3 papers in Dermatology, 3 papers in Parasitology and 2 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Nathalie Ivanoff’s work include Parasites and Host Interactions (3 papers), Research on Leishmaniasis Studies (2 papers) and Hidradenitis Suppurativa and Treatments (2 papers). Nathalie Ivanoff is often cited by papers focused on Parasites and Host Interactions (3 papers), Research on Leishmaniasis Studies (2 papers) and Hidradenitis Suppurativa and Treatments (2 papers). Nathalie Ivanoff collaborates with scholars based in France, United States and Germany. Nathalie Ivanoff's co-authors include Nigel C. Phillips, Hartmut Göbel, S. Díaz-Insa, M. Falqués, Peter J. Goadsby, Nina De Klippel, G Zanchin, G Géraud, J Fortea and Gilles Riveau and has published in prestigious journals such as Infection and Immunity, The Journal of Pediatrics and Thorax.
